On days when you want a warm and light meal that is gentle on your body, this spinach and broccoli soup recipe will do the trick. The broccoli gives the soup some substance, and the spinach adds vibrant green colour and freshness without overwhelming the rest of the ingredients. Therefore, this soup is green; it has a great balance and would be delicious for both lunch and dinner.
The soup is so easy to make. It’s made in one pot, with no thickening agents or lengthy cooking required. 2 cupsBroccoli florets
1½ cupsSpinach leaves
1 mediumOnion, chopped
2 clovesGarlic, chopped
1 tbspOlive oil or butter
3 cupsVegetable stock
to tasteSalt
½ tspBlack pepper
a pinchNutmeg (optional)
2 tbspFresh cream or milk (optional)
